Some Bounds on Zeroth-Order General Randić$ Index

arXiv:1909.03288

Abstract

For a graph without isolated vertices, the inverse degree of a graph is defined as where is the number of vertices adjacent to the vertex in . By replacing by any non-zero real number we obtain zeroth-order general Randić index, i.e. where is any non-zero real number. In \cite{xd}, Xu et. al. determined some upper and lower bounds on the inverse degree for a connected graph in terms of chromatic number, clique number, connectivity, number of cut edges. In this paper, we extend their results and investigate if the same results hold for . The corresponding extremal graphs have been also characterized.
